Air Fryer Sweet Potato Cubes with Garlic Parmesan Recipe

Crispy on the outside and tender on the inside, these Air Fryer Sweet Potato Cubes are seasoned with garlic powder and finished with a generous sprinkle of Parmesan cheese, making a deliciously savory and healthy side dish or snack.

Ingredients

Sweet Potato Cubes

  • 1 lb sweet potatoes, peeled and cubed
  • 1 tbsp olive oil
  • 1 tsp garlic powder
  • 1/2 tsp salt
  • 1/4 tsp black pepper

Topping

  • 2 tbsp grated Parmesan cheese

Instructions

  1. Preheat Air Fryer: Preheat your air fryer to 400°F to ensure it reaches the optimal temperature for even cooking and crisping.
  2. Toss Sweet Potatoes: In a mixing bowl, combine the peeled and cubed sweet potatoes with olive oil, garlic powder, salt, and black pepper. Toss thoroughly to coat each cube evenly with the seasoning and oil.
  3. Air Fry: Place the seasoned sweet potato cubes in the air fryer basket in an even layer. Cook for 12 to 15 minutes, shaking the basket halfway through to promote even cooking and browning.
  4. Add Parmesan: Once cooked and crispy, remove the sweet potatoes from the air fryer. While still hot, immediately toss them with the grated Parmesan cheese, allowing it to melt slightly and adhere to the cubes.

Notes

  • For extra crispiness, avoid overcrowding the air fryer basket to allow proper air circulation.
  • You can substitute Parmesan with nutritional yeast for a vegan option.
  • Adjust the garlic powder and salt according to your taste preference.
  • Serve immediately for the best texture, but leftovers can be reheated in the air fryer.
